Once you feel you have actually exhausted your research study, take a seat and start designing your questions. Beginning with a couple of very easy, less-important questions, enabling the interviewee to "heat up" to the experience, obtain made use of to the cam and really feel at ease with you, the recruiter. Once you really feel all is in order, begin relocating through the concerns created by your research study, placing questions so one streams from the last.When doing the meeting, it is important to pay attention to your topics' answers so you can react with a follow-up (that you might not have prepared); if the interviewee has actually not answered the concern to your complete satisfaction or claims something that is valuable to your messaging and is unforeseen, you require to be all set to respond. - video production

If your subject items, your bases have already been covered, and you must have what you require, with no more word. Constantly guarantee you have the proper punctuation and title of any kind of interviewee on electronic camera, at the start, ask for the spelling of your topic's name and for a title.
Be particular to thank your topics at the end of the meeting! There are 2 crucial elements to assume concerning when you are deciding where to film an interview: light and audio. In a perfect world, you would be filming in a quiet environment. Anticipate where sound could originate from.
If you do choose to film outside, take into account such things as web traffic noise, howling kids, the click-clack of skateboards and other disruptive audios. From an aesthetic point of view, ensure that you make up the setting of the sun when you determine in which instructions to film. Movie with indirect sunlight whenever feasible.
Choose an area where you are able to control the light or utilize it to your benefit. Keep in mind which equipments may produce background noise (think air conditioning) and see if you are able to transform them off for the interview.

It is additionally important to make sure that you have sufficient room for every one of your equipment, especially when utilizing lights packages. Make sure there suffice easily accessible electric outlets to run the equipment. When you have actually ticked every one of the above boxes, pick a history that is not obtrusive and is pleasant to take a look at.
Occasionally you might make a decision to place the topic in front of a man-made background, like a black matte. This type of decision may be made because no other suitable background exists, or you are trying to produce a particular mood. Make sure the locations and shots of each of the interviewees will collaborate.
